Huge rescue mission for man deep in Turkey cave

By Jordi Bou

September 8, 2023 - Rescuers from across Europe are racing to save an American cave explorer trapped in Turkey’s third deepest cave complex.

Around 170 doctors, paramedics and experienced cavers from several countries – including Bulgaria, Croatia, Hungary, Italy, Poland and Turkey – are working to rescue Mark Dickey, 40, who became trapped in the Morca Cave on Sep 2.

Yusuf Ogrenecek, of the Turkish caving federation, said one of the most difficult tasks of cave rescue operations was widening narrow passages to allow stretcher lines to pass through at low depths.

The operation is expected to take several days.

Cave rescues at depths of more than 1,000m are relatively uncommon.

In 2014 a man was evacuated from a depth of 1,148m at the Riesending cave in Bavaria, Germany. Some 728 people were involved in the operation, which took 11 days.
